FDA Approves Ragwitek for Short Ragweed Pollen Allergies

Silver Spring, Maryland—(ENEWSPF)—April 17, 2014.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ration today approved Ragwitek, the first allergen extract administered under the tongue (sublingually) to treat short ragweed pollen induced allergic rhinitis (hay fever), with or without conjunctivitis (eye inflammation), in adults 18 years through 65 years of age.
